Apparel Industry Reality

Common challenges in factory operations

Current Operational Status

  • Production data is scattered across multiple Excel files, making it hard to sync and prone to errors.

  • Hard to track line productivity in real-time to intervene immediately during bottlenecks.

  • Internal processes still heavily rely on manual paperwork and signing, wasting time.

  • Lack of automated Dashboards to support fast management decisions.

Barriers to Large ERP Systems

"Why not just buy an ERP system?" Here is the reality:

  • Excessive Costs: Initial investment budgets (licenses, servers) and annual maintenance costs exceed most factory capacities.

  • Hard to Customize: Massive systems are often rigid and difficult to adapt to the specific needs and culture of each workshop.

  • Long Implementation: Setup times lasting months or years cause operational disruption and discourage staff.

Design Philosophy

A different approach to digital transformation

Instead of forcing factories into a giant system from the start, AKA Lab builds Micro-apps that solve specific business problems based on 3 core principles:

1. Micro-apps – Solving specific problems

Each software module is designed to be lightweight, focusing on 1-2 specific tasks (like leave requests or inventory entry). This allows for ultra-fast deployment (1-3 weeks) without factory disruption.

2. Strict Permissions & Ease of Use

Interfaces are tailored for each user. Workers have simple mobile screens, while managers have control dashboards. Everyone does their part with minimal training time.

3. Data Convergence for Management

Despite being separate small apps, at the foundation, data is connected and centralized into a single source of truth. Directors always have a real-time dashboard of the entire factory.

Expert Perspective

AKA Lab's Transformation Philosophy

01

Where to start digital transformation?

Don't start by spending a fortune on massive ERP software. Abrupt changes often lead to resistance from the workshop team.

"Start by standardizing the smallest, most 'painful' process. For example: leave requests or payroll data."

When workers find using a mobile app for leave more convenient than writing on paper, they automatically form a digital habit. From this small habit, applying more complex software becomes infinitely easier.


02

Data: Excel or Centralized Systems?

Excel is a great tool for individuals but a "nightmare" for enterprise management. The difference between patching together end-of-day Excel reports and having a Real-time Dashboard is massive.

When data is entered at the source (e.g., QC entering errors on the line) and instantly appears on the Manager's screen, you move from passive reaction to proactive management.

Value of a Single Source of Truth:

  • 100% of departments look at the same numbers.
  • Zero downtime spent on "report synthesis."
  • Accurate historical data ready for future AI forecasting.

03

People: The key to software success

Why do so many software projects fail on the floor? Because the designers sit in air-conditioned offices, while the users are workers on noisy production lines.

Workshop interfaces must be large, clear, and 'tap-friendly', minimizing text input. AKA Lab invests heavily in UX/UI so that even older workers with minimal smartphone experience can report defects or productivity in just two taps.
